Photosynthesis and Cellular Respiration Study Guide Integrated Science 3 REFERENCE 10/14 Name: Per. THE QUIZ WILL CONSIST OF MULTIPLE CHOICE, MATCHING QUESTIONS, AND AT LEAST 1 SHORT ANSWER QUESTION ON PHOTOSYNTHESIS AND CELLULAR RESPIRATION. BRING A PENCIL AND A CALCULATOR. USE THIS STUDY GUIDE TO PREPARE FOR THE QUIZ. TEST DATE: Photosynthesis 1. Notes and Worksheet: Photosynthesis Reading Questions, Photosynthesis PowerPoint and accompanying notes, The Effect of Light Intensity on Photosynthetic Rate, Photosynthesis Review State the purpose of and write a balanced equation for the process of photosynthesis. Identify the reactants and products of this reaction. List the reactants and products of the light-dependent reaction. Where does this process occur in the cell? List the reactants and products of the light-independent reaction. Where does this process occur in the cell? Explain the role in photosynthesis of each term listed and used in the Photosynthesis Review worksheet. Discuss how light intensity influences the rate of photosynthesis. What might be an implication of this as it relates to human carrying capacity? 2. Activities: Plant Pigments and Photosynthesis and Absorption of Chlorophyll Identify pigments used in photosynthesis and explain how chromatography is used to identify them. How does chromatography work? Explain the function of plant pigments. Calculate Rf values, given a chromatogram and relevant distances traveled by solvent and pigments. Cellular Respiration 1. Notes and Worksheet: Cellular Respiration Reading Questions, Cellular Respiration PowerPoint and accompanying notes, Comparing Photosynthesis and Cellular Respiration State the purpose of and write the overall equation for cellular respiration. Identify the reactants and products of this reaction. Identify and briefly describe the 3 steps of cellular respiration (glycolysis, Krebs cycle, and electron transport). Identify the locations in the cell where these reactions occur. Note how many molecules of ATP are produced from 1 molecule of glucose in aerobic cellular respiration Describe the relationship between photosynthesis and cellular respiration.
